WestPoint Stevens Inc. appoints new President Chief Operating Officer
Fontenot comes to WestPoint Stevens from Dyersburg Corporation, where he was President and Chief Operating Officer for the past two years, responsible for restructuring its knit fabric operations to cut costs and improve its competitive position. Mr. Fontenot has spent more than 30 years in the home fashions and textile industries, having served in various capacities at Springs Industries during a 20-plus-year tenure that included President of Springs' Consumer Products Division. As Chairman, President, and Chief Executive Officer of Perfect Fit Industries, Fontenot helped assemble a management team that grew sales at a compounded rate of 9%-10% before selling the company five years later to Foamex International.
Holcombe T. Green Jr.,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of WestPoint Stevens, commented, "We are delighted to have Chip join our company. He embodies the attributes our Board of Directors was looking for in a prospective President and Chief Operating Officer: strong leadership ability; sales and marketing expertise; and, most importantly, a strategic sense regarding the future challenges and opportunities likely to face WestPoint Stevens and the home fashions industry."
WestPoint Stevens Inc. is the nation's leading home fashions consumer products marketing company, with a wide range of bed linens, towels, blankets, comforters, and accessories.
